Description

The Blue Sea PowerBar 600A BussBar is an essential component for any serious marine or automotive electrical system. Designed for professionals and enthusiasts alike, this BussBar features eight 3/8"-16 studs, making it ideal for high-current applications. Whether you're setting up a new electrical system or upgrading an existing one, the Blue Sea PowerBar provides a reliable solution for managing power distribution.

This BussBar is rated for a maximum current of 600 amps and supports a maximum voltage of 300V AC or 48V DC, making it versatile for a variety of applications. Its robust design allows for straightforward installation and maintenance, ensuring that you can keep your electrical system running smoothly. Constructed to withstand harsh conditions, it is suitable for both marine and automotive environments.

Boaters, RV owners, and automotive enthusiasts will find that the Blue Sea PowerBar 600A BussBar enhances the safety and efficiency of their power systems. It is especially beneficial for complex setups where multiple circuits need to be managed effectively. With its high current capacity and reliable performance, this BussBar is a smart choice for optimizing electrical systems.
